A home with a sense of contemporary style that's spiced with midcentury modern sensibilities is on the market for $1,550,000 in the Fauboug Marigny.

The 2017 home, at 641 St. Ferdinand St. in New Orleans, was designed in a style similar to the owner's previous home, which originally was designed by John Ekin Dinwiddie, dean of Tulane University's architecture school in the late '50s.

The walls of maple paneling in the Marigny house are also featured in the previous home, as well as a corrugated exterior.

The style of the steel-framed structure fits well into the neighborhood, reminiscent of the many warehouses and storage buildings common in the sector. It sits on three separate lots, forming an L-shaped property on a corner that's just steps from the Mississippi River and the New Orleans Center for the Creative Arts.

Inside, modern conveniences are fitted into the midcentury mystique. Three bedrooms and 3½ baths are artfully laid out in the 2,385 square feet of polished concrete floors.

An expansive living area, lit with clerestory windows, glows with polished maple and exposed beams, with barn-door style closures for floor-length windows. A marble fireplace is prominent on the paneled wall. The windows are all 135 mph wind rated.

The open kitchen features quartzite counters with contrasting cobalt cabinetry and stainless appliances. An adjacent dining area has a wall of windows overlooking the gardens and an entertaining area.

An angled hall with a half bath leads to the bedroom and office areas. The primary bedroom, with more clerestory windows, has a large walk-in closet and a spa-like bath.

The two additional bedrooms in the home feature en suite baths as well.

The gardens and exterior spaces, complete with a koi pond, provide a plethora of options for entertaining, as well as optimal spots for displaying sculptural art. The walled gardens provide privacy as well as off-street parking.
